{"id":39248,"date":"2026-01-16T16:12:39","date_gmt":"2026-01-16T15:12:39","guid":{"rendered":"https:\/\/magrid.education\/?page_id=39248"},"modified":"2026-01-23T14:33:59","modified_gmt":"2026-01-23T13:33:59","slug":"special-education-math-adhd","status":"publish","type":"page","link":"https:\/\/magrid.education\/fr\/special-education-math-adhd\/","title":{"rendered":"Supporting Math Learning for Students with ADHD in Special Education"},"content":{"rendered":"<section data-bb-version=\"5.5.9\" id=\"bt_bb_section69d782566e95a\"  class=\"bt_bb_section bt_bb_layout_boxed_1200\"  data-bt-override-class=\"null\"><div class=\"bt_bb_port\"><div class=\"bt_bb_cell\"><div class=\"bt_bb_cell_inner\"><div class=\"bt_bb_row\"  data-bt-override-class=\"{}\"><div class=\"bt_bb_row_holder\" ><div data-bb-version=\"5.5.9\"  class=\"bt_bb_column col-xxl-12 col-xl-12 col-xs-12 col-sm-12 col-md-12 col-lg-12 bt_bb_vertical_align_top bt_bb_align_left bt_bb_padding_normal bt_bb_shape_inherit\" style=\"; --column-width:12;\" data-width=\"12\" data-bt-override-class=\"{}\"><div class=\"bt_bb_column_content\"><div class=\"bt_bb_column_content_inner\"><div data-bb-version=\"5.5.9\" class=\"bt_bb_separator bt_bb_border_style_none bt_bb_top_spacing_normal bt_bb_bottom_spacing_normal\" data-bt-override-class=\"{&quot;bt_bb_top_spacing_&quot;:{&quot;current_class&quot;:&quot;bt_bb_top_spacing_normal&quot;,&quot;def&quot;:&quot;normal&quot;},&quot;bt_bb_bottom_spacing_&quot;:{&quot;current_class&quot;:&quot;bt_bb_bottom_spacing_normal&quot;,&quot;def&quot;:&quot;normal&quot;}}\"><\/div><div data-bb-version=\"5.5.9\"  class=\"bt_bb_text\" ><\/p>\n<p>\u00a0<\/p>\n<p><strong>Supporting Math Learning for Students with ADHD in Special Education<\/strong><\/p>\n<h6 dir=\"ltr\" style=\"line-height: 1.38; margin-top: 18pt; margin-bottom: 4pt;\">Understanding ADHD and Its Impact on Learning<\/h6>\n<p dir=\"ltr\" style=\"line-height: 1.38; margin-top: 12pt; margin-bottom: 12pt;\">Attention-Deficit\/Hyperactivity Disorder (ADHD) is one of the most common neurodevelopmental conditions in U.S. schools. Approximately 9.8% of children aged 3 to 17 have received an ADHD diagnosis, according to the <a href=\"https:\/\/www.cdc.gov\/ncbddd\/adhd\/data.html\" target=\"_blank\" rel=\"noopener\">Centers for Disease Control and Prevention<\/a>. Students with ADHD often show curiosity, creativity and problem-solving strengths. They can also experience challenges with sustained attention, working memory and sequencing, which are foundational for mathematics learning.<\/p>\n<p dir=\"ltr\" style=\"line-height: 1.38; margin-top: 12pt; margin-bottom: 12pt;\">T<a href=\"https:\/\/www.apa.org\/topics\/adhd\" target=\"_blank\" rel=\"noopener\">he American Psychological Association notes<\/a> that ADHD involves differences in executive functions. These differences can make it harder to organise steps, retain numerical information and complete multi-step tasks. In special education settings, effective math instruction benefits from structure, movement and visual supports. These help students engage with abstract ideas while reducing attention fatigue.<\/p>\n<h6 dir=\"ltr\" style=\"line-height: 1.38; margin-top: 18pt; margin-bottom: 4pt;\">Why Math Is Especially Challenging for Students with ADHD<\/h6>\n<p dir=\"ltr\" style=\"line-height: 1.38; margin-top: 14pt; margin-bottom: 4pt;\"><strong>Executive Function and Working Memory<\/strong><\/p>\n<p dir=\"ltr\" style=\"line-height: 1.38; margin-top: 12pt; margin-bottom: 12pt;\">Mathematical reasoning depends on working memory. Students must hold numbers in mind, follow steps, and compare quantities. The U.S. Institute of Education Sciences, through the <a href=\"https:\/\/ies.ed.gov\/ncser\/\" target=\"_blank\" rel=\"noopener\">National Center for Special Education Research<\/a>, highlights the importance of executive functions and working memory for academic outcomes in learners with disabilities. Instruction that lightens memory load, for example through visual scaffolds and stepwise practice, can improve accuracy and persistence.<\/p>\n<p dir=\"ltr\" style=\"line-height: 1.38; margin-top: 14pt; margin-bottom: 4pt;\"><strong>Attention Regulation and Cognitive Load<\/strong><\/p>\n<p dir=\"ltr\" style=\"line-height: 1.38; margin-top: 12pt; margin-bottom: 12pt;\">Students with ADHD often experience variable attention. Short, clearly structured math tasks can reduce cognitive load and help learners stay engaged. Visual cues, immediate feedback and chunked problem sets are associated with better on-task behaviour and more consistent performance. These adjustments fit within evidence-informed special education practice, including multi-tiered supports and data-based decision making promoted under <a href=\"https:\/\/sites.ed.gov\/idea\" target=\"_blank\" rel=\"noopener\">IDEA<\/a>.<\/p>\n<h6 dir=\"ltr\" style=\"line-height: 1.38; margin-top: 18pt; margin-bottom: 4pt;\">Evidence-Based Teaching Strategies<\/h6>\n<p dir=\"ltr\" style=\"line-height: 1.38; margin-top: 14pt; margin-bottom: 4pt;\"><strong>1.
